Getting There

  • Car

    If you're traveling by car, head to Victor Harbor via the main roads. From the southern parts of Fleurieu Peninsula, take the Main South Road (A13) north, then turn onto Victor Harbor Road (B37) which will take you directly into Victor Harbor. Once in Victor Harbor, follow Flinders Parade, and you will find the National Trust Museum at 1 Flinders Parade. Parking is available nearby, but be mindful of any parking fees that may apply.

  • Public Transportation

    For those using public transportation, you can take a bus from various towns in Fleurieu Peninsula to Victor Harbor. The Southlink bus service operates routes that connect to Victor Harbor. Check the schedule for the most convenient route. Once you arrive at the Victor Harbor bus terminal, it's a short walk to the museum. Head down Ocean Street towards Flinders Parade, and you will reach the museum within about 10 minutes on foot.

  • Walking

    If you are already in Victor Harbor, walking to the National Trust Museum is an easy and pleasant option. From the town center, head towards the waterfront and take Ocean Street towards Flinders Parade. Follow Flinders Parade along the coast, and you will see the museum at 1 Flinders Parade. The walk is scenic and takes about 15 minutes.

Discover more about National Trust Museum

Nestled along the stunning coastline of Victor Harbor, the National Trust Museum is a gem for history enthusiasts and casual visitors alike. This charming establishment serves as a portal into the rich tapestry of local history, showcasing artifacts that tell the stories of the region's past. From early settlers to Indigenous culture, each exhibit invites you to explore the fascinating narratives that have shaped this beautiful area. The museum's collection is thoughtfully curated, highlighting the unique aspects of Victor Harbor's heritage. You’ll find everything from historical photographs to personal memorabilia that bring the past to life. The friendly and knowledgeable staff are always on hand to provide insights and answer any questions, making your visit not just informative but also interactive. The museum is open daily from 11 AM to 3 PM, allowing ample opportunity for tourists to immerse themselves in the local culture.
